The Gist
America built its military around the idea that we'd always have the best technology and fight short wars without losing much equipment. But wars in Ukraine and against Iran show that cheap drones and robots are now winning battles, while we're running low on our expensive missiles. We need to completely change our military to focus on building lots of cheaper, autonomous weapons instead of a few super-expensive ones.
Conclusion
The U.S. military must fundamentally restructure from expensive, exquisite weapons systems to lower-cost, autonomous, mass-producible systems to remain competitive in modern warfare
Premises
- America's military was built on outdated assumptions of technological superiority, military primacy, and short wars with minimal losses
- Current and future conflicts will feature contested battlefields where the U.S. will lose many platforms and need to replace them through sustained production
- Ukraine and Iran conflicts demonstrate that autonomous drones and lower-cost systems are now decisive in warfare
- Peer competitors are successfully disrupting the traditional American way of war using these new technologies
- The U.S. is burning through expensive munitions stockpiles faster than anticipated, revealing production capacity limitations
- Future warfare will require mass-producible systems that can be rapidly replaced rather than small numbers of irreplaceable expensive platforms
Assumptions
- Technological disruption in warfare is permanent and accelerating
- America's historical military advantages are eroding permanently
- Mass production capacity will be more strategically valuable than individual platform superiority
- Autonomous systems can effectively replace many traditional military functions
- Current conflicts accurately predict future warfare patterns
